Persian Gulf Tensions: A Century-Long Struggle

Tensions in the Persian Gulf have a chronic feature of international relations for over a century. Longstanding rivalries between regional actors, coupled with global ambitions, result in a volatile environment.

Access over the strategically important waterways of the Gulf, along with its vast oil reserves, remains a primary source of contention.

Recurring crises have occurred throughout history, often driven by political tensions and external interventions.

The region's complex dynamics continue to challenge to global peace and stability.

Tensions Flare: Can Iran Ignite Nuclear Conflict?

The world scrutinizes with bated breath as Iran's nuclear ambitions surge. Global powers are increasingly concerned that Tehran's pursuit of atomic capabilities could trigger a regional crisis. The Iranian government claims its program is legitimate, but observers remain dubious. The risk of accidental escalation looms large over the region, and any misstep could lead to unimaginable destruction.
